Hi Steve
One other thing if you are using a windows platform.
CF11 is now built on Tomcat. Not much of a problem EXCEPT that some (but not
all) file names will be case sensitive in some applications. Wasted a day on
that
one trying to debug an application that had worked fine on CF9.

Hi Brian
Its for PCI compliance for doing credit card transctions. control scan keeps
reporting Port 3306 being open to the internet.
I just need coldfusion to access Mysql. I used FreeSShd to create a ssh tunnel
which I can access on port 22 from Navicat on my desktop, So I can administer
the
